About The Position

The Senior Certified Outpatient Coder will be a part of an emerging coding team under the billing and credentialing service that performs coding review for FQHCs. The Outpatient Coder will report to Director of Revenue Integrity and is responsible for performing coding audits on ambulatory medical records for multi-specialty provider organizations to ensure billed codes are accurately supported by the clinical documentation. The Senior coder will ensure accurate diagnosis and procedure coding, as well as providing documentation and coding related feedback to providers and coders. Responsible for interpreting medical record data in language that the payers can interpret in order to process physician charges, and is compliant with all coding guidelines.

Responsibilities

  • Serves as an expert on coding guidelines
  • Assigns appropriate diagnosis codes (ICD-10) and procedure codes (CPT/HCPCS) to patient encounters based on medical documentation, physician notes, and other information
  • Ensures all coding is completed in a timely manner to meet billing deadlines
  • Communicate with healthcare providers to clarify coding questions and concerns
  • Participates in improvement efforts and documentation training for medical and clinical staff
  • Recommend improvements to workflows in Epic to facilitate accurate documentation
  • Stay abreast of coding and documentation guidelines, compliance policies, annual coding updates, payer policies and industry changes
  • Conduct regular audits to monitor coding accuracy and identify areas for improvement or education to coding staff
  • Performs Denial analysis to identify trends related to coding
  • Identify coding/documentation trends that may pose a risk to revenue stream and report such trends to management team
  • Continuously improve coding processes and contribute to the overall success of the team
  • Provide recommendations to manager for the most efficient utilization of assigned personnel
  • Acts as department resource for special projects and coding related questions and issues
